Personal Care Support
Dignified, respectful assistance with daily personal care — designed to preserve independence, comfort, and self-esteem.
What Our Care Partners Provide
- ✓Bathing, showering, and sponge baths
- ✓Grooming: hair washing, shaving, oral hygiene
- ✓Toileting and continence care
- ✓Dressing and clothing selection
- ✓Mobility assistance and safe transfers
- ✓Positioning and pressure care support
- ✓Skincare and basic foot care
- ✓Medication reminders
- ✓Vital sign monitoring as directed
Who This Helps
Personal care is ideal for anyone experiencing difficulty with daily hygiene and physical tasks due to ageing, chronic illness, disability, post-surgical recovery, or reduced mobility. It's often the service that allows someone to continue living safely and comfortably at home rather than transitioning to a long-term care home, retirement home, or assisted living.

Companionship Care
Meaningful connection, shared experiences, and emotional support — because social wellbeing is just as important as physical health.
What Companionship Looks Like
- ✓Engaging conversations and active listening
- ✓Shared hobbies: reading, games, crafts, music
- ✓Accompanying on outings and appointments
- ✓Meal preparation and dining together
- ✓Light walks and gentle exercise encouragement
- ✓Social activity coordination
- ✓Phone and video call support with family
- ✓Mental stimulation activities
- ✓Emotional support during difficult times
Who This Helps
Companionship care is particularly valuable for anyone living alone, those who have recently experienced loss, individuals whose family live at a distance, or anyone experiencing social isolation. Research shows that loneliness poses serious health risks — regular companionship genuinely improves quality of life and overall wellbeing.

Respite Care
Scheduled, professional relief for family caregivers — so you can rest, work, and recharge without worrying about your loved one's wellbeing.
How Respite Care Works
- ✓Flexible scheduling: hours, days, or weeks
- ✓Emergency respite when you need unexpected coverage
- ✓All personal care and daily living support covered
- ✓Consistent, familiar Care Partner where possible
- ✓Detailed handover and communication with family
- ✓Night care and overnight coverage
- ✓Weekend and holiday coverage
- ✓Travel coverage for extended trips
- ✓Post-surgery recovery support
Who This Helps
Respite care is designed for family members and informal caregivers who need scheduled relief from their caregiving responsibilities. Taking regular breaks is not selfish — it's medically recommended. Caregiver burnout leads to poorer outcomes for everyone. Respite care helps you recharge and continue providing the best possible support.

Palliative Care
Sensitive, compassionate care during life's final chapter — focused on comfort, dignity, and creating meaningful time with the people your loved one cherishes.
Palliative Care Support
- ✓Pain and symptom management support
- ✓Emotional and spiritual comfort care
- ✓Personal hygiene and comfort measures
- ✓Positioning and pressure relief
- ✓Family support and caregiver guidance
- ✓Coordination with palliative medical teams
- ✓Companionship and presence
- ✓Meaningful activity facilitation
- ✓Grief support for family members
Who This Helps
Palliative care is for families navigating life-limiting illness or end-of-life care. Our Care Partners in this area are specially trained for the emotional and physical demands of this work. We understand that this is one of the most profound experiences a family goes through, and we approach it with the utmost respect, gentleness, and dignity.
